Student Data Privacy and List of Instructional Technology

Regional School District 10 is committed to protecting the privacy of its students, faculty and staff. The district complies with State and Federal legislative regulations such as the Connecticut Act Concerning Student Data Privacy (PA 16-189) and the Family Educational Rights and Privacy Act (FERPA). PA 189 requires Boards of Education to enter into written contracts with consultants and operators (collectively, "contractors") prior to providing contractors with, or allowing them access to student information, student records or student generated content. This law further requires boards to provide written notice of execution of such a contract and post such notice on the board’s website, along with the executed contract. All software in use by the district must be vetted and approved before use. 

Approved software vendors have either signed the CT Student Data privacy pledge at the Educational Software Hub or entered into an agreement with Regional School District 10.  

Compliance with the Children's Internet Protection Act (CIPA) is achieved through Fortinet and Linewize web filtering platforms.
